What is SEO?

SEO stands for search engine optimization. What this means is that a search engine, primarily Google, is put at the forefront when it comes to quality and quantity of any content on your website. There are many different aspects that go into SEO and all of them could affect how your website ranks. When a user enters in a search query, they are shown a list of results. This is what is referred to as the search engine results page. The goal of SEO is to allow a website or web page to rank higher on the search engine results page. However, this algorithm that determines these rankings is ever changing. But, there are some good practices that you can implement to consistently enhance your SEO.

Quality Content 

One of the most important aspects that goes into search engine optimization is quality content. Content can be in the form of blog posts, service pages, and landing pages. Creating content gives you a means of connecting with your audience and a way to build a foundation of trust with your audience. When creating content, it is important that you place quality above quantity. This is both beneficial for building a foundation with your audience and for ranking higher in search engines. This is because inaccurate content or content filled with spam can lead a search engine to deem that website or web page untrustworthy.

Similarly, users who stumble upon the page are unlikely to stay for too long or return to your website. Instead, focus on topics that would appeal to your ideal audience and try to provide them with answers to common questions they may have in the form of helpful content.

Usability 

How well does your website work? If you notice glitches, videos not working, or text not showing up properly, chances are your usability is pretty low. This can affect how users view your web pages and your website overall. They may not be able to navigate to certain pages or even make a purchase. To make matters worse, they may not even decide to stay on your website at all. Afterall, first impressions are everything. In order to make sure you have proper usability, you will want to make sure you have a fast loading time, all extensions work properly, and that every aspect of your website is in working order. Keep in mind that usability can change over time, so it is important to check it often. One way you can check it is with Google’s PageSpeed Insights. What is Organic Traffic?

Organic search traffic is when traffic is garnered through effective SEO practices versus paid avenues. While paid avenues can prove to be effective, SEO practices are generally regarded as being more long term solutions. Paid ads generally are put at the top of the search engine results pages before the organic search. These posts may have a tag that says, “sponsored”, which will be above the post. The post may also have a highlighted title tag in the search engine results page. However, paid ads are not necessary to boost your traffic. Effective SEO writing can lead to a boost in search engine result rankings and therefore boost organic traffic all on its own. What is SEO Writing?

What is SEO writing content? SEO writing is taking the best practices of search engine optimization and applying them to writing content. This content could be used for service pages, home pages, contact pages, and blog posts. Anywhere that has text on your website can benefit from SEO writing. Search Intent

After you have narrowed down some key factors about your website, it is important to understand search intent. Search intent is what a user wants to gain from making a search query. A search query is what a user will enter into the search box. Typically, a user will want to either find information, do something, find a website, or go somewhere in person. Discovering the user’s intent goes hand-in-hand with keywords. Keywords are words that a user may use when typing up a search query that relates to your website. For instance, a user may search for shirts. In the results page, a user will be shown many options to purchase a shirt. This is because users that generally search for shirts are looking to purchase one. For instance:

Keyword Research

Keyword research takes time and a great deal of planning in order to get it right. Although many tend to overlook this crucial planning phase, it is important to take your time and research properly. You may know which words you want to rank for on the search engine results page, but that is not the only thing to keep in mind. You will want to put your audience at the forefront and recognize whether or not those are the same keywords that your audience will be looking for. This will prove to allow you to get more conversions than if you were to disregard your audience.

In order to get to know your audience a little better to find the right keywords, you will want to ask certain questions. Let’s go back to our “shirts” example. You will want to ask yourself how you can give your audience the best content about shirts and answer their questions that they have about shirts. Why would someone want a shirt? Where are the people’s locations who would buy your shirts? Who wants these shirts? What types of shirts are these people looking for? The answers to these questions will help to point you in the right direction on which keywords you should be targeting. You can also use one of the many keyword research tools available online. Research The Competition 

It is important to remember that copying your competition is not a thoughtful strategy for the long run and is unlikely to pan out in the way you would hope. Copying can lead to mistrust between you and your audience, as well as bonds within the industry being broken. However, your competition can provide you with lots of useful information when it comes to finding out who your ideal audience is. Look at your competition’s most interacted with posts, whether they are on social media or on their website. This will give you clues to who is following them and interested in their information, services, or products. This is also a great way to view which types of ways to present information to that audience works best, as you will be able to see interactions with those posts. Get Hired by An Agency

Agency work can provide you with more consistent work than attempting to obtain clients on your own. While this is not always the case, it generally provides SEO writers with more security. An agency may or may not hire you as an employee. Instead, they may take you on as an independent contractor. This means they do not need to provide you with benefits and you will need to sign a contract. Finding an agency can sometimes be tricky. However, searching for some in your local area is generally a good place to start. Many places may also offer remote opportunities, so it doesn’t hurt to search outside of where you are located.

SEO, or Search Engine Optimization, is the process of increasing the quality and quantity of organic traffic to your website by optimizing content and images.

Keywords are topics that describe what your content is all about. In SEO, they are words that a user types into the search bar. Pages are displayed according to their relevance to the searched keyword.

According to our growth experts, it will usually take 3-6 months to see ranking improvement through SEO techniques. This, of course, is dependent on the industry and popularity of your keywords.

Keywords need to be used naturally in your writing and the writing should be relevant to your business. Avoid keyword stuffing which could be penalized by Google. Google uses keywords to determine the order of pages on SERPs.

Use one main keyword then choose 4-5 secondary keywords that support and are relevant to your main keyword. Try to choose words that will distinguish your website from the crowd.
